ix, 734 pp. A guide to North American Wood Warblers and their habits, by the American ornithologist commissioned by the Smithsonian Institution to publish what was at the time the most comprehensive repository of knowledge about the biology of the birds of North America. It was released from 1919-1968 (the final two volumes were completed and released after his death). He won the John Burroughs Medal in 1940, as well as the Daniel Giraud Elliot Medal from the National Academy of Sciences in 1949.
